The pet shop al barsha Diaries
Pet Corner provides a variety of top quality food selections, comfy bedding, and entertaining pet toys. The professional personnel is able to guideline clients in deciding on the best goods for their pets, ensuring each and every check out is pleasing and practical. A renowned chain of pet stores in Dubai from the title of Petland is greatly known